BENTON COUNTY HIGHWAY DEPARTMENT is a regulation and administration of transportation programs employer in FOWLER, IN. Federal records show 1 OSHA inspection with 6 violations and $24,500 in penalties. 1 workplace fatality investigation on record. All data sourced from public federal enforcement records.
